Best Universities for Computer Science: Top Programs in 2025

In the digital era, the demand for computer science professionals is more pronounced than ever before. Technology is changing fast. Graduates from the best computer science (CS) programs will lead the way in creating innovations that shape our world. Careers in computer science offer endless possibilities. You can work in fields like artificial intelligence, cybersecurity, and cloud computing. The options are vast and exciting.

But where should you start your journey in the world of computer science? Choosing the right university can be tough. There are hundreds of schools around the world with great programs. This guide looks at the best computer science universities for 2025. We explore their top programs, faculty, and research options. Each school has unique features that set it apart in this rapidly changing field.

Why Computer Science Education Matters in 2025

Computer science now plays a key role in almost every part of modern life. Computer science impacts nearly every industry, from healthcare and finance to entertainment and space exploration. Choosing the right university for computer science is very important for students. It can greatly affect their future.

1. Innovative Curriculum Design

Leading universities are constantly evolving their curriculum to incorporate the latest advancements in technology and research. By 2025, computer science programs will have specialized tracks. Students can choose fields like AI, data science, quantum computing, or cybersecurity. This will keep them updated on the latest industry trends.

2. Access to Industry-Leading Research

The best computer science universities offer substantial opportunities for students to engage in groundbreaking research. These universities let students work on AI algorithms, cybersecurity, and new software. They also offer chances to team up with top experts and industry leaders.

3. Strong Industry Connections

Top universities work closely with major tech companies such as Google, Microsoft, and Apple. This connection helps students find internships, job opportunities, and hands-on projects. These connections are vital for making the transition from university to the tech industry smooth and rewarding.

Top Universities for Computer Science in 2025

These schools are often ranked as the best in the world for computer science education. They bring together top faculty, innovative research, and solid industry connections. This helps students succeed in computer science.

1. Massachusetts Institute of Technology (MIT) – USA

Program Highlights:

  • MIT’s Department of Electrical Engineering and Computer Science (EECS) is consistently ranked as the top computer science program worldwide, offering a blend of theory, practice, and interdisciplinary research.
  • The university’s Computer Science and Artificial Intelligence Laboratory (CSAIL) is a global leader in AI and robotics research, providing students with direct access to groundbreaking projects.
  • MIT has many undergraduate and graduate programs. You can study machine learning, cryptography, data science, and software engineering.

At MIT, computer science students learn more than just from textbooks. They innovate and shape the future of technology. The university focuses on entrepreneurship, research, and innovation. This makes it a great choice for students eager to lead in the tech world.

2. Stanford University – USA

Program Highlights:

  • Stanford’s School of Engineering, particularly the Department of Computer Science, is renowned for its research in artificial intelligence, machine learning, and software engineering.
  • The university is in Silicon Valley. This location gives students great access to internships, job opportunities, and networking events. They can connect with big tech companies like Google, Apple, and Facebook.
  • Stanford boasts a strong startup ecosystem. It gives computer science students a chance to team up with tech entrepreneurs. They can also work on real-world projects.

Stanford’s proximity to Silicon Valley offers an advantage that few other universities can match. Students gain from a strong entrepreneurial culture and modern research. This prepares them to join one of the world’s most vibrant tech ecosystems.

3. Carnegie Mellon University (CMU) – USA

Program Highlights:

  • CMU’s School of Computer Science is widely regarded as one of the best in the world, known for its interdisciplinary approach and innovation in fields like AI, robotics, and human-computer interaction.
  • The Robotics Institute and Institute for Software Research at CMU provide students with access to world-class research centers where they can engage in collaborative projects.
  • Carnegie Mellon has great ties to the industry. Tech companies often recruit CMU graduates for top jobs.

Carnegie Mellon is famous for its interdisciplinary research. This lets students address complex challenges in computer science. Whether it’s robotics or AI, CMU provides a unique learning environment where students push the boundaries of innovation.

4. University of California, Berkeley (UC Berkeley) – USA

Program Highlights:

  • UC Berkeley’s Department of Electrical Engineering and Computer Sciences (EECS) ranks among the top in the nation. It focuses on both theory and practical uses of computer science.
  • The university leads the world in AI, data science, and cybersecurity research. Students collaborate with top faculty on exciting projects.
  • UC Berkeley connects well with Silicon Valley. This link creates great networking and job chances. Many graduates find jobs at top tech companies or start their own successful businesses.

UC Berkeley’s reputation for producing top-tier computer science graduates is well-earned. The university emphasizes research, innovation, and entrepreneurship. It’s a great choice for anyone wanting to impact the tech industry.

5. University of Cambridge – UK

Program Highlights:

  • The University of Cambridge’s Department of Computer Science and Technology is renowned for its rigorous programs and strong focus on both theoretical and practical aspects of computer science.
  • Cambridge is well-known for its work in artificial intelligence, computer vision, and machine learning.
  • The university ranks highly for research output. Students can often work on exciting projects with industry partners.

Cambridge has a strong reputation for excellence in computer science education. Its focus on interdisciplinary research also makes it a great choice for students. They can gain a deep and well-rounded education in this field.

6. ETH Zurich – Switzerland

Program Highlights:

  • ETH Zurich’s Department of Computer Science is considered one of the leading computer science programs in Europe, offering top-tier research and education in fields such as machine learning, software engineering, and cybersecurity.
  • The university is famous for its interdisciplinary approach. It lets students work on projects that mix computer science with engineering, life sciences, and economics.
  • ETH Zurich connects students with top European tech companies and research groups. This gives them access to valuable internships and collaboration opportunities.

ETH Zurich is an excellent option for students. It offers a strong computer science education and global research chances. The university is known for innovation. Its location in Europe’s tech hub makes it a top choice for future computer scientists.

What to Consider When Choosing a Computer Science University

Choosing the right university for your computer science degree is crucial. It can shape your career path significantly. Here are some factors to keep in mind when choosing the right program:

1. Specialization Areas

Some universities excel in specific areas of computer science, such as AI, data science, cybersecurity, or robotics. Research the university’s strengths and see if their program aligns with your specific interests and career goals.

2. Research Opportunities

Top universities provide great research chances. Students can join exciting projects and work with faculty. Think about if the university has solid research centers and good ties with industry in your field of interest.

3. Industry Connections and Career Support

Seek universities with strong links to top tech firms. These ties can offer internships, job chances, and networking events. Career support services and alumni networks help students find jobs after graduation.

4. Location and Resources

The location of the university can play a big role in your education and career prospects. Schools in tech hubs like Silicon Valley and London provide better access to internships and job options. Also, think about the university’s resources. Look at research labs, hardware, and software options.

5. Accreditation and Reputation

Ensure the university is accredited and has a strong reputation in the field. Check the school’s rankings, faculty, and reputation in computer science. This way, you can be sure you’re getting a great education.

Conclusion:

With technology continuing to evolve rapidly, computer science is more crucial than ever. The universities in this guide are the top choices in the field. They offer students a world-class education, research chances, and strong industry links. If you like artificial intelligence, software engineering, or data science, these schools have the programs, teachers, and tools for your success.

In 2025, the future of computer science looks brighter than ever. Choosing one of these top universities will prepare you to drive innovations that shape technology and society’s future.

Publicaciones Similares

Deja una respuesta

Tu dirección de correo electrónico no será publicada. Los campos obligatorios están marcados con *